《Web开发技术》教学大纲_第1页
《Web开发技术》教学大纲_第2页
《Web开发技术》教学大纲_第3页
《Web开发技术》教学大纲_第4页
《Web开发技术》教学大纲_第5页
已阅读5页,还剩1页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

《Web开发技术》课程教学大纲一、课程概述课程名称Web开发技术英文名称Webdevelopmenttechnology课程性质考查课程代码22124023总学时理论32学时+实验8学时学分2开课学期第四学期先修课程程序设计基础、面向对象程序设计、计算机导论适用专业计算机科学与技术开课单位计算机与电气工程学院二、课程简介《Web开发技术》是一门综合性、实践性较强的课程,是面向计算机科学与技术专业开设的一门重要专业选修课,也列入该专业培养方案的主干课程群。本课程是随着计算机科学及互联网技术的发展而逐步形成的一门新兴的语言类课程,形成于二十一世纪初,是研究HTML元素结构、形式及相互关系的学科。随着WEB应用的发展,用户交互式应用越来越普及,网页用户交互页面不但要体现良好视觉效果,还对交互体验提出了更高要求。课程在教给学生HTML文件基本结构、表格表单、框架和CSS等技术知识的同时,重点培养学生的实践动手能力,并具有运用所学的知识与技能培养学生页面结构设计能力与外观修饰能力。三、课程目标《Web开发技术》是面向计算机科学与技术专业的主干课程,具有概念多、技能性较强、操作实验强度要求高、应用广泛的特点。本课程主要讲授HTML和Web标准以及HTML文件基本结构、复杂网页设计及制作等方面的基础知识。通过本课程的学习,不仅使学生掌握进一步学习其他课程所必需的前端用户界面设计知识,而且可培养学生使用WEB前端设计知识在基于B/S应用系统设计过程中分析问题与解决实际问题的能力。课程教学基本要求如下:课程目标1:具备网页用户界面设计的形象思维能力、结构设计能力、建模能力;(支撑毕业目标3.3)课程目标2:具备运用前端设计工具及方法构建Web站点和APP界面等解决具体问题的能力;(支撑毕业目标9.2)课程目标3:具备运用前端设计工具及方法,培养学生的创新意识,设计特色网页。(支撑毕业目标11.3)四、课程目标对毕业要求指标点的支撑表4-1课程目标对毕业要求指标点的支撑毕业要求毕业要求指标点课程目标1233设计/开发解决方案3.3能基于设计结果实现满足特定需求的计算机软/硬件功能模块连接和系统设计,并在设计过程中体现创新意识;M9个人和团队9.2能够在团队中独立或合作开展工作;L11项目管理11.3能够在多学科环境下,将工程管理与经济决策方法应用于计算机应用系统的设计、开发与实施的各环节。L五、教学内容及实施手段表5-1教学内容与进度要求教学章节小节内容要求具体要求学生成果课程目标学时一.绪论(1)了解Internet与万维网的概念(2)HTML、CSS与JavaScript的概念与特点(3)了解HTML5与CSS3的(1)概念与特点认知1.了解HTML静态网页结构2.掌握HTML网页布局。3.了解HTML基本语法以及常用标签掌握HTML文档结构元素HEAD和BODY,能构建符合规范的HTML文档,并在浏览器正确显示;掌握HEAD中META的使用方法,掌握标记对应的使用;课程目标12学时(4)掌握任意一款开发工具,并进行相关练习认知1.编辑HTML内容,包含文字效果,文字修饰和段落<p>掌握HTML中常见的格式标记,并能在网页设计熟练运用这些标记对网页进行排版;课程目标1二.HTML5基础(1)HTML5的基本结构(2)HTML5中元素标签的作用(3)HTML5中文档注释的用法理解1.了解列表的定义和常用列表的分类。2.掌握定义列表基本语法,理解定义列表与无序、有序列表的外在表现上的差异3.学会使用列表type属性的改变列表的符号样式。4.掌握有序列表基本语法。学会使用列表type、start属性的改变列表的编号样式5.了解使用有序列表项value属性改变列表项编号设计熟练运用这些标记对网页进行排版;课程目标22学时(4)HTML5中保留的常用标签的用法(5)HTML5中新增的文档结构标签的用法(6)HTML5中新增的格式标签的用法理解6.容器标签的使用通过对容器标签等新增标签的使用使学生对整体布局有了新的体验课程目标2三.HTML5标签的使用HTML5中超链接标签HTML5中图像IMG的运用认知1.掌握超链接A的表示方法,并能使用它表示指向其它网页、文件的链接形式;学习文本链接、图像链接及热区的创建。2.掌握网页设计图像IMG的运用,背景图像、不同格式的图像在网页设计中的作用,图像链接;1.让学生了解超链接的书写方法。2.通过超链接的设置,让学生初步掌握获取交互式信息的方法。3.通过插入超链接,制作实现自由跳转的到各个页面。课程目标12学时HTML5中相对路径和绝对路径的区别认知4.初步了解规划超链接的路径问题,掌握相对路径和绝对路径的区别。5.通过超链接的设置,实现网页内容的自由跳转。6.掌握图像超链接的基本语法及创建方法。掌握网页设计图像IMG的运用,背景图像、不同格式的图像在网页设计中的作用,图像链接;课程目标2四.表格基础(1)掌握HTML中表格工具TABLE的使用,并规范网页的数据显示认知1.掌握使用表格布局网页。2.灵活掌握表格调整的方法。3.设置表格行与单元格。4.初步了解表格合并的基本方法。5.熟练掌握细线表格实现表格在网页中的应用课程目标22学时五.表单基础(1)熟练掌握表单Form的设计(2)对文本框、按钮、下拉列表、单选和复选按钮等多种表单元素能熟练运用熟悉1.掌握网页中插入表单并设置各种属性。2.掌握网页中插入各种列表标记的使用。3.掌握框架网页的建立方法。4.练习使用表单,包括其action及method属性,6.熟练掌握单选框、复选框和按钮等内容练习使用表单中的元素,包括文本框、列表框、文本域,让学生掌握多个对话框的相关应用课程目标22学时六.多媒体标签(1)HTML5音频和视频(2)HTML5支持的格式熟悉1.掌握嵌入多媒体的技术。2.理解不同音频与视频在不同浏览器上的兼容性问题。3.设置占位图片跑马灯marquee标签的使用。4.插入多媒体文件。5.添加背景音乐课程目标2七.CSS基础(1)CSS基本语法(2)CSS的选择器及CSS复合选择器理解1.掌握层叠样式表CSS的基本概念、语法,熟练掌握常见CSS的属性及值的写法;2.掌握如何在网页中使用三种不同的形式调用样式表;3.掌握HTML标签选择器、类选择器、ID选择器以及伪类选择器和对象选择器的使用,掌握CSS的复合选择器的使用;能够熟练使用CSS元素对网页中元素的外观进行控制课程目标12学时(3)CSS的继承性(4)CSS的属性及值(5)如何在网页中应用CSS样式掌握4.掌握CSS中的继承概念;掌握CSS盒子模型的相关概念,使用CSS+DIV技术进行网页布局的设计课程目标3八.CSS3技术(1)CSS3边框和背景效果(2)CSS3文本和字体效果(3)CSS3变形与动画效果认知1.CSS3边框和背景效果2.掌握CSS3文本和字体效果3.掌握CSS3中2D变形与动画效果能够熟练使用CSS3的动画效果,增加整体布局意识课程目标32学时五、考核与评价方式及标准1、考核与评价方式及标准课程考试主要采用开卷方式,考试范围涵盖所有讲授的内容,考试内容应能客观反映出学生对本门课程主要原理技术的掌握程度,对有关理论、原理的理解、掌握及综合运用能力。(1)平时表现及讨论:占总成绩的10%。要求:教师针对重要知识点组织相应的课堂讨论,重点考察学生的学习态度、自主学习能力、团队协作能力、语言表达能力与沟通能力。六、参

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论